12 | /** | |
7f196c93 FA |
13 | * Bitrate targets for different resolutions, at VideoTranscodingFPS.AVERAGE. |
14 | * | |
edb4ffc7 FA |
15 | * Sources for individual quality levels: |
16 | * Google Live Encoder: https://support.google.com/youtube/answer/2853702?hl=en | |
17 | * YouTube Video Info (tested with random music video): https://www.h3xed.com/blogmedia/youtube-info.php | |
18 | */ | |
c1978779 | 19 | function getBaseBitrate (resolution: VideoResolution) { |
edb4ffc7 | 20 | switch (resolution) { |
8137c8b9 C |
21 | case VideoResolution.H_240P: |
22 | // quality according to Google Live Encoder: 300 - 700 Kbps | |
23 | // Quality according to YouTube Video Info: 186 Kbps | |
24 | return 250 * 1000 | |
25 | case VideoResolution.H_360P: | |
26 | // quality according to Google Live Encoder: 400 - 1,000 Kbps | |
27 | // Quality according to YouTube Video Info: 480 Kbps | |
28 | return 500 * 1000 | |
29 | case VideoResolution.H_480P: | |
30 | // quality according to Google Live Encoder: 500 - 2,000 Kbps | |
31 | // Quality according to YouTube Video Info: 879 Kbps | |
32 | return 900 * 1000 | |
33 | case VideoResolution.H_720P: | |
34 | // quality according to Google Live Encoder: 1,500 - 4,000 Kbps | |
35 | // Quality according to YouTube Video Info: 1752 Kbps | |
36 | return 1750 * 1000 | |
ad3405d0 | 37 | case VideoResolution.H_1080P: |
8137c8b9 C |
38 | // quality according to Google Live Encoder: 3000 - 6000 Kbps |
39 | // Quality according to YouTube Video Info: 3277 Kbps | |
40 | return 3300 * 1000 | |
ad3405d0 C |
41 | case VideoResolution.H_4K: // fallthrough |
42 | default: | |
43 | // quality according to Google Live Encoder: 13000 - 34000 Kbps | |
44 | return 15000 * 1000 | |
edb4ffc7 FA |
45 | } |
46 | } | |

48 | /** |
49 | * Calculate the target bitrate based on video resolution and FPS. | |
2f71dcf8 FA |
50 | * |
51 | * The calculation is based on two values: | |
52 | * Bitrate at VideoTranscodingFPS.AVERAGE is always the same as | |
53 | * getBaseBitrate(). Bitrate at VideoTranscodingFPS.MAX is always | |
54 | * getBaseBitrate() * 1.4. All other values are calculated linearly | |
55 | * between these two points. | |
7f196c93 | 56 | */ |
0229b014 | 57 | export function getTargetBitrate (resolution: VideoResolution, fps: number, fpsTranscodingConstants: VideoTranscodingFPS) { |
7f196c93 FA |
58 | const baseBitrate = getBaseBitrate(resolution) |
59 | // The maximum bitrate, used when fps === VideoTranscodingFPS.MAX | |
60 | // Based on numbers from Youtube, 60 fps bitrate divided by 30 fps bitrate: | |
2f71dcf8 FA |
61 | // 720p: 2600 / 1750 = 1.49 |
62 | // 1080p: 4400 / 3300 = 1.33 | |
7f196c93 FA |
63 | const maxBitrate = baseBitrate * 1.4 |
64 | const maxBitrateDifference = maxBitrate - baseBitrate | |
65 | const maxFpsDifference = fpsTranscodingConstants.MAX - fpsTranscodingConstants.AVERAGE | |
66 | // For 1080p video with default settings, this results in the following formula: | |
67 | // 3300 + (x - 30) * (1320/30) | |
e243c38c FA |
68 | // Example outputs: |
69 | // 1080p10: 2420 kbps, 1080p30: 3300 kbps, 1080p60: 4620 kbps | |
2f71dcf8 | 70 | // 720p10: 1283 kbps, 720p30: 1750 kbps, 720p60: 2450 kbps |
7f196c93 FA |
71 | return baseBitrate + (fps - fpsTranscodingConstants.AVERAGE) * (maxBitrateDifference / maxFpsDifference) |
72 | } | |
